INTOLERANT


Meaning of INTOLERANT in English

■ adjective (often ~ of ) not tolerant of views, beliefs, or behaviour that differ from one's own.

↘unable to take or consume a food or medicine without adverse effects.

↘(of a plant or animal) unable to endure specified conditions or treatment.

Derivatives

intolerance noun

~ly adverb
